Chest physiotherapy in the newborn: effect on secretions removed |
Etches PC, Scott B |
Pediatrics 1978 Nov;62(5):713-715 |
clinical trial |
3/10 [Eligibility criteria: No; Random allocation: No; Concealed allocation: No; Baseline comparability: No; Blind subjects: No; Blind therapists: No; Blind assessors: No; Adequate follow-up: Yes; Intention-to-treat analysis: No; Between-group comparisons: Yes; Point estimates and variability: Yes. Note: Eligibility criteria item does not contribute to total score] *This score has been confirmed* |
The amount of upper airway secretions removed by suction alone was compared to that removed after chest physiotherapy in six neonates with a clinically suspected problem of increased respiratory tract secretions. More secretions were removed after physiotherapy.
